Generally, it can be a good thing for some people. It's definitely not for everybody though. Often, I think people take tattoos way too lightly. It's not exactly like a piercing that generally barely leave any visible marks if you change your mind after getting one. That's why it's actually a bit of a relief to see threads like this since it's evidence that the person is actually trying to take into consideration all the possibilities about the tattoo.
There are times when people jump into it lightly thinking "Well it's my body and I'll do what I want with it and you can't stop me!" and in situations like that it can end up being more about defiance than anything, and that is just not healthy. Especially when people end up with tattoos that they either hate later, or are deliberately offensive to other people.
There are also the health aspects of it-- some people are allergic to the ink. Some people get infections. If you don't choose the tattoo artist/parlour carefully, you could end up gettin a dirty needle, and all the problems that would carry with it. If you have a low pain tolerance, you may not be able to handle having a large tattoo done-- definitely a consideration since you don't want to have to say stop halfway through. Despite lowering inhibitions, you still have a very likely chance of not being able to get a job at a certain facitility if you have a tattoo. The same applies to piercings, but since you can take piercings out they are generally more lenient than tattoos, which either have to be covered up or gotten rid of. And you can't necessarily blame the businesses that have such policies.
More freedom is good and all, but it always comes with more responsibility, and people really need to keep that in mind.
